Universal imaging utility program
First Claim
1. A method for cloning an operating system from a first computer having a hard drive containing an operating system, the method comprising:
- generating a minimum basic functional level configuration of the operating system by;
stripping at least one driver file, system file or registry setting from the operating system; and
resetting at least one driver file, system file or registry setting;
wherein the minimum basic functional level configuration is bootable on a plurality of different computer hardware configurations;
further wherein generating the minimum basic functional level configuration of the operating system is performed on an operating system currently running on the first computer.

Abstract
A method and program for setting up a Master computer for imaging a computer hard drive from one hardware platform to a second, dissimilar hardware platform is disclosed. The program will be deployed onto a first computer. The program strips down the operating system files, hardware driver files, and registry settings of the computer to a very basic level, and resets certain system files, driver files, and registry settings. The Master computer may then be cloned or imaged onto a second computer without the second computer crashing. The program allows cloning and conversion between computers, even if the computers are different models or are made by different manufacturers.
